Product Care Guide
Plaster
Dust with a soft, dry cloth only. Plaster is porous, so avoid all liquid cleaners — they'll stain or mark the surface. Raw plaster fittings can be painted: use a matte emulsion in two thin coats, allowing each to dry fully before powering on. Don't install in bathrooms or other damp areas unless the IP rating allows it.
Brass & metal
Brass develops a natural patina over time, which most people prefer. To keep the current finish, wipe gently with a soft, dry cloth. For a brighter look, use a brass-specific polish sparingly. Never use lemon, vinegar, or abrasive cleaners — these damage lacquered brass irreversibly. Polished chrome and nickel finishes can be wiped with a damp microfibre cloth.
Glass
Wipe with a soft, damp cloth and dry thoroughly to avoid water marks. For stubborn marks, a mild glass cleaner is fine. Always ensure the fitting is switched off and fully cool before cleaning.
Fabric shades
Dust with a soft brush or vacuum on the lowest setting using an upholstery attachment. Avoid wet cleaning — fabric shades can stain, warp, or shrink. Spot-clean small marks only with a barely-damp microfibre cloth.
Ceramic
Glazed ceramic can be wiped with a soft, damp cloth and a mild soap solution. Unglazed or matte ceramic should be kept dry and dusted only. Always ensure the fitting is switched off and cool first.
Before you clean
Switch off at the wall and let the fitting cool fully. Never spray cleaner directly onto a fitting — apply to a cloth first. If your fitting has visible wiring, electrical components, or LED drivers exposed, keep moisture well away from these areas.

Questions
Does the Oslo ceiling light need to be installed by an electrician?
Yes, the Oslo is hardwired and must be installed by a qualified electrician in compliance with UK Building Regulations Part P. It connects directly to your mains ceiling circuit, typically via a BESA box or ceiling rose. Installation involves isolating the circuit, securing the backplate to the ceiling, and making the electrical connections according to the provided instructions.
What type of bulb does this fitting take and is it included?
The Oslo takes a single E27 screw bulb with a maximum wattage of 11W, which is not included. We recommend using an LED E27 bulb for energy efficiency—an 11W LED typically produces around 1000-1100 lumens, equivalent to an old 75W incandescent. Choose a warm white (2700K-3000K) to complement the forest green shade and natural wood base.
Can the Oslo semi-flush light be dimmed?
Yes, the Oslo is dimmable when fitted with a compatible dimmable E27 bulb. You'll need to install a trailing edge dimmer switch to control the light level smoothly without flickering. Both the dimmer and the bulb must be dimmable—standard non-dimmable LED bulbs will not work with a dimmer circuit.
What are the dimensions and how far does it hang from the ceiling?
The Oslo measures 300mm in diameter and has a total height of 180mm from the ceiling to the bottom of the shade. As a semi-flush fitting, it sits close to the ceiling, making it ideal for rooms with lower ceilings or spaces where a full pendant would hang too low, such as hallways, landings, or compact bedrooms.
Is this light suitable for bathroom use?
No, the Oslo has an IP20 rating, which means it offers no protection against moisture and is only suitable for dry indoor areas. It cannot be safely installed in bathrooms or any zone-rated areas where water or steam is present. For bathrooms, you would need a light with a minimum rating of IP44 or higher depending on the zone.
Which rooms work best with this single-bulb ceiling light?
With one E27 lampholder accepting up to 11W (roughly 1000 lumens with LED), the Oslo works well as primary lighting in smaller spaces like hallways, landings, cloakrooms, or cosy bedrooms up to around 10-12 square metres. In larger kitchens or living rooms, it's better suited as accent or secondary lighting rather than the main source, or consider installing multiple fittings for adequate coverage.
